Wienerberger Nevada Buff Facing Brick
The Wienerberger Nevada Buff is an extruded wirecut facing brick with a dragfaced texture and a soft buff tone. Its clean finish and subtle surface variation make it suitable for a wide range of projects, from traditional builds to contemporary designs. As with all clay products, shade variation is expected, so blending bricks from at least three packs on site is advised to achieve a consistent appearance. This brick delivers dependable performance alongside visual appeal, offering frost resistance, strong compressive strength, and low water absorption levels for long-lasting durability in UK conditions.
Key Specifications
-
Size:215mm × 102.5mm × 65mm
-
Colour:Buff
-
Texture:Extruded, Wirecut, Dragfaced
-
Water Absorption:? 10%
-
Durability:F2
-
Compressive Strength:? 50 N/mm²
-
Pack Quantity:504
-
Gross Dry Density:1200 kg/m³
-
Thermal Conductivity:0.690 W/(m·K)
-
Size Tolerance:T2
-
Range Tolerance:R1
-
Active Soluble Salts:S2
-
Reaction to Fire:Class A1
Description & Usage Notes
Manufactured at the Sandown works, the Nevada Buff is produced using the extruded wirecut process with a dragfaced finish that adds subtle texture to its smooth buff tone. With water absorption ? 10% and compressive strength ? 50 N/mm², it provides excellent durability and resilience, making it ideal for external facing walls.
The F2 frost resistance rating ensures suitability under normal UK exposure conditions. To achieve long-term performance, correct construction detailing is essential, including cavity design, drainage, flashing, and appropriate mortar selection. Blending bricks from multiple packs during installation helps reduce visible banding.
FAQs
Is ? 10% water absorption suitable for external walls?
Yes — this low level of absorption helps manage moisture effectively when combined with good construction detailing.
What does the F2 durability rating mean?
It indicates the brick is frost-resistant and suitable for normal UK external exposure conditions.
Will the buff tone vary between packs?
Yes — natural shade variation is expected. Mixing bricks from at least three packs helps achieve a consistent finish.
